12. Shadow Of The Colossus Was Essentially Monster Hunter

One of the most moving and impactful titles of the last 10 years, Team ICO's followup to the first princess-rescuing tale that gave them their namesake didn't start out as the heart string-pulling opus it would end up as. Instead, you wouldn't play as one adventurer in Wander, but as a team of people all assembling alongside the Colossi to take them down. If you've played Monster Hunter or seen the phenomenal Attack of Titan anime then you've got a pretty good idea of what a group of Davids tackling a Goliath looks like, and although Shadow turned out spectacularly in the end anyway, this group aesthetic is a really sweet idea that should see the light of day in the future.
